
微信小程序电商实战课程:前后端开发详解
下载需积分: 5 | 845.34MB |
更新于2024-12-12
| 199 浏览量 | 举报
1
收藏
课程基于SpringBoot2和Vue3这两个主流技术栈,结合MySQL数据库、Mybatis Plus、JWT技术实现前后端分离,并使用微信小程序原生技术实现前端界面与功能,以及Vue3.2和Element Plus构建后台管理系统。
课程内容详细介绍了以下知识点:
1. 微信小程序前端开发技术,包括axios异步请求、Promise异步操作、swiper轮播组件、自定义组件的使用方法。在前端部分还涉及了微信小程序登录、支付、地址管理等核心功能的实现。同时,课程中也讲授了如何使用ngrok工具实现本地服务器映射,以便在开发环境中演示真实支付功能。
2. 后端开发技术,主要是SpringBoot2+Mybatis Plus框架的使用,课程中涵盖了后端接口的实现,如商品分类显示接口、热门推荐商品接口等,并展示了如何将前端axios异步请求与后端接口对接。
3. Vue3.2框架和Element Plus组件库的使用,这部分内容是关于后台管理系统的构建,讲解了axios+Promise工具类封装、自定义icon、vuex状态管理、router路由配置、路由守卫等后台管理系统的实现细节。
4. Element Plus组件库的应用,具体包括表格、分页、图片上传、下拉框、二级联动、Form表单、rules验证框架、dialog组件等的使用方法。同时,还介绍了一款第三方的vue-quill富文本编辑器组件。
通过这一系列课程的学习,学员可以掌握微信小程序的电商实战开发流程,了解前后端分离架构的设计与实现,并且能够独立开发具备完整功能的电商小程序。课程中还提供了一些实际操作的演示视频文件,如项目介绍与功能演示、后端接口实现、样式实现等,帮助学员更直观地理解和学习相关技术。
总的来说,本套课程不仅覆盖了微信小程序开发的基础知识,还深入到具体的技术实现细节,适合有志于开发微信小程序电商平台的技术人员进行学习。"
【标题】:"微服务架构设计与实践"
【描述】:"微服务架构是目前软件开发领域广泛采用的一种架构模式,它旨在通过拆分大型单体应用为一系列小服务,以提升系统的可维护性、可伸缩性和灵活性。本课程深入解析了微服务架构设计的核心理念,详细介绍了Spring Boot、Spring Cloud、Docker、Kubernetes等技术的使用方法,并且通过案例演示了微服务架构的实践过程。
课程内容涵盖了服务注册与发现、服务配置中心、断路器、API网关、链路追踪、分布式事务处理等微服务关键技术。同时,本课程还注重微服务的安全问题,深入讲解了服务的安全策略和防护措施。"
【标签】:"微服务架构 Spring Boot Docker Kubernetes"
【压缩包子文件的文件名称列表】: 第1讲 微服务架构设计概览.mp4、第12讲 Spring Cloud Config配置中心实现.mp4、第8讲 服务注册与发现Eureka实践.mp4、第5讲 断路器Hystrix应用.mp4、第10讲 分布式链路追踪SkyWalking应用.mp4、第14讲 分布式事务Seata处理.mp4、第11讲 API网关Zuul实现.mp4、第7讲 Docker基础与容器化部署.mp4、第9讲 Kubernetes集群管理与编排.mp4
课程详细讲解了微服务架构下的服务注册与发现、服务配置中心、API网关、链路追踪、分布式事务处理等关键技术,并强调了微服务安全的重要性,包括安全策略和防护措施。
课程内容包括:
1. 微服务架构设计的核心理念和特点,课程开篇即对微服务架构进行了概览,为学员提供了整体理解。
2. Spring Boot和Spring Cloud的使用,Spring Boot用于快速构建和开发微服务,而Spring Cloud为微服务提供了一整套解决方案,包括服务注册与发现组件Eureka,服务配置中心Spring Cloud Config,API网关Zuul,分布式链路追踪SkyWalking,以及分布式事务管理Seata等。
3. Docker容器化技术的介绍,课程详细讲解了Docker的基础知识以及如何在微服务架构中进行容器化部署。
4. Kubernetes集群管理与编排,本课程也深入解析了Kubernetes的使用方法,包括如何管理微服务容器化部署后的集群,并进行有效的资源调度和编排。
5. 安全策略和防护措施,微服务架构下的安全问题不容忽视,课程中也对服务的安全策略和防护措施进行了深入讲解。
通过本课程的学习,学员不仅可以获得微服务架构设计的理论知识,还能掌握微服务架构下的各项关键技术应用,并了解如何利用Docker和Kubernetes进行微服务的部署和管理。同时,课程还强调了微服务的安全设计,帮助学员构建出安全、可靠、可维护的微服务架构应用。"
相关推荐





















weixin_46247837
- 粉丝: 0
最新资源
- 任务悟空iOS APP:GitHub高效管理工具
- 深入探索Spring MVC源码测试实践
- Go语言实现的P2P存储系统Pepper项目分析
- 金蝶系统销售单汇率修改限制及二次开发要点
- 仓库管理系统前端实现及wms私有仓库介绍
- 小学一年级家长会卡通PPT模板下载
- 探索PyGE项目:Python编写的古腾堡项目电子文本访问工具
- DPX4Mac:在Mac OS X中完美支持DPX图片格式
- 掌握k6进行高效接口性能测试
- Fire:一键访问六大Torrent搜索站点的开源工具
- 直播礼物SVG动画套装:即刻使用无修改
- 克林贡语开源Perl模块发布
- elcanbus: 探索ELM327 canbus开源工具及其逆向工程应用
- XML到LDAP数据转换开源工具介绍
- Android AdAway HOST文件更新暂停信息
- Activiti7工作流引擎学习资料大全
- Go共享库中导出C变量的实验与实践
- 简化网络日志发布的开源工具JPA介绍
- 探索tangular:一个独特的Angular随机应用
- 开源工具集:创建PNG/ASCII/WAVE及音频视频内容
- 手动打包工具:高效文件管理解决方案
- UVic课程项目实践:首次使用Github管理作业
- 如何将嵌入式Linux设备设置为WiFi热点
- Unchecky for Firefox:防止自动勾选安装插件